Justin Bieber India concert tour is reportedly slated in May this year and Beliebers in India were very happy to hear the news of the Canadian pop star's arrival to India this year. He will perform at DY Patil Stadium in Mumbai, on May 10.

The speculations were doing rounds for a few days, however, White Fox India, the promoters of his ''Purpose World Tour'' confirmed that the 22-year-old ''Love Yourself'' singer will perform in India as part of his grand tour.

So the Bieber fans are waiting for a hotter summer this year with the temperatures soaring with the groovy tunes of "No Sense," ''Purpose,'' "Sorry" and other singles which he has been performing throughout last year as a part of his gala ''Purpose World Tour.''

In his fourth studio album, Bieber has matured as a singer and has experimented with electronic sounds. According to India today, the bookings for tickets will open from Feb. 22 and the fans can log on to Book My Show and begin the countdown.

The tickets are starting with a price tag of Rs. 4000 and the VIP tickets will run into several thousands. "This tour is one of the most successful in the world at the moment and will further enhance India's current cultural repertoire'' stated Arjun Jain, the director of White Fox India.

The organizers are expecting a full house in the show in spite of high prices of the tickets. Apart from India, Bieber will perform in Dubai in UAE and Tel Aviv in Israel. It clearly shows that music crosses the boundaries of countries and touches the hearts of people across the globe.
